ACME: An International E-Journal for Critical Geographies, Vol 10 No 2 is now available. It includes the English version of a discussion between me, Derek Gregory and Álvaro Sevilla-Buitrago that was originally published earlier this year in a Spanish translation: Spaces of the Past, Histories of the Present. The interview is wide ranging, and discusses Nietzsche, Heidegger, Foucault, Lefebvre et. al.; the relation of history to geography; contemporary politics; our future work; publishing, etc.
